Erinevus lehekülje "ATA over Ethernet kasutamine Debianiga" redaktsioonide vahel

Allikas: Kuutõrvaja
 
(ei näidata sama kasutaja 7 vahepealset redaktsiooni)
1. rida: 1. rida:
 
===ATA over Ethernet===
 
===ATA over Ethernet===
  
AOE (ATA over Ethernet) protokoll võimaldab tulemuse mõttes sarnaselt iSCSI'ile teha plokkseadme üle etherneti võrgu kättesaadavaks. Seejuures on AOE'le iseloomulikud järgmised asjaolud
+
AOE (ATA over Ethernet) protokoll võimaldab tulemuse mõttes sarnaselt iSCSI'ile teha ühe arvuti plokkseadme üle etherneti võrgu teisele arvutile kättesaadavaks. Seejuures on AOE'le iseloomulikud järgmised asjaolud
  
 
* puudub osaliste autentimine
 
* puudub osaliste autentimine
 
* ei kasutata IP protokolli, toimetatakse otse etherneti frame'idega
 
* ei kasutata IP protokolli, toimetatakse otse etherneti frame'idega
 
* töötab vaid sama subneti piires
 
* töötab vaid sama subneti piires
 +
* väga lihtne käima seada
  
Tundub, et AOE'sse suhtutakse üldiselt kui nö vaese mehe SAN'i (ingl. k. Storage Area Network), aga ta siiski töötab.
+
Tundub, et AOE'sse suhtutakse üldiselt kui nö vaese mehe SAN'i (ingl. k. Storage Area Network) ja ehk võib öelda, et SAN'induse jaoks on tegu sarnase robustsusega rakendusega nagu on programm socket (või netcat) TCP/IP protokolli jaoks.
  
 
===Tarkvara paigaldamine===
 
===Tarkvara paigaldamine===
21. rida: 22. rida:
 
===AOE kasutamine===
 
===AOE kasutamine===
  
Serveri tuleb öelda
+
Serveri tuleb öelda, kusjuures protsess jääb foreground'i
  
 
   # vblade 11 1 eth1 /dev/system/test
 
   # vblade 11 1 eth1 /dev/system/test
28. rida: 29. rida:
  
 
   # vblade shelf slot netif filename
 
   # vblade shelf slot netif filename
 +
 +
Kasutamiseks sobivam moodus on kasutada seadistusfaili /etc/vblade.conf, mis sisaldab rida
 +
 +
  eth1 11 1 /dev/system/test
 +
 +
Kui lisada rea lõppu veel mac aadress, saab piirata millisest arvutist teenusele ligipääs on lubatud. Arusaadavalt peab kasutaja ise otsustama kas selline piirang on piisav.
 +
 +
Teenuse käivitamiseks ja seiskamiseks tuleb öelda vastavalt
 +
 +
  # /etc/init.d/vblade start | stop
  
 
Kliendis näeb subnetis olevaid AOE seadmeid öeldes
 
Kliendis näeb subnetis olevaid AOE seadmeid öeldes
56. rida: 67. rida:
  
 
* http://en.wikipedia.org/wiki/ATA_over_Ethernet
 
* http://en.wikipedia.org/wiki/ATA_over_Ethernet
 +
* http://www.coraid.com/

Viimane redaktsioon: 30. november 2008, kell 01:28

ATA over Ethernet

AOE (ATA over Ethernet) protokoll võimaldab tulemuse mõttes sarnaselt iSCSI'ile teha ühe arvuti plokkseadme üle etherneti võrgu teisele arvutile kättesaadavaks. Seejuures on AOE'le iseloomulikud järgmised asjaolud

  • puudub osaliste autentimine
  • ei kasutata IP protokolli, toimetatakse otse etherneti frame'idega
  • töötab vaid sama subneti piires
  • väga lihtne käima seada

Tundub, et AOE'sse suhtutakse üldiselt kui nö vaese mehe SAN'i (ingl. k. Storage Area Network) ja ehk võib öelda, et SAN'induse jaoks on tegu sarnase robustsusega rakendusega nagu on programm socket (või netcat) TCP/IP protokolli jaoks.

Tarkvara paigaldamine

Serverisse tuleb paigaldada pakett vblade öeldes

 # apt-get install vblade

Klienti tuleb paigaldada pakett aoetools öeldes

 # apt-get install aoetools

AOE kasutamine

Serveri tuleb öelda, kusjuures protsess jääb foreground'i

 # vblade 11 1 eth1 /dev/system/test

kus on kasutusel süntaks

 # vblade shelf slot netif filename

Kasutamiseks sobivam moodus on kasutada seadistusfaili /etc/vblade.conf, mis sisaldab rida

 eth1 11 1 /dev/system/test

Kui lisada rea lõppu veel mac aadress, saab piirata millisest arvutist teenusele ligipääs on lubatud. Arusaadavalt peab kasutaja ise otsustama kas selline piirang on piisav.

Teenuse käivitamiseks ja seiskamiseks tuleb öelda vastavalt

 # /etc/init.d/vblade start | stop

Kliendis näeb subnetis olevaid AOE seadmeid öeldes

 # aoe-stat 
    e11.1        17.179GB   eth0 up

Seadme kasutamiseks tuleb öelda näiteks

 # mount /dev/etherd/e11.1 /mnt

Diagnostika

Selleks, et teha kindlaks, kas AOE serveris on ressurss olemas sobib öelda

 # aoeping -v 11 1 eth0
 tag: 80000000
 eth: eth0
 shelf: 11
 slot: 1
 config query response:
 00 16 3e 08 65 2f 00 1b 21 1d f6 06 88 a2 18 00 
 00 0b 01 01 80 00 00 00 00 10 40 0c 02 10 00 00 
 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 
 00 00 00 00 00 00 00 00 00 00 00 00 b3 54 d0 01

Kasulikud lisamaterjalid